NCOC and West Dala LLP familiarized representatives of Makat district community and state bodies with the waste management complex.

Another visit to the waste management facilities of specialized organization "West Dala" LLP was organized for representatives of Makat district community and state bodies in order to familiarize them with the methods and technologies applied in the industrial waste management.

The waste management facility (WMF) is located at the distance of eight kilometres along Atyrau – Uralsk highway in Makhambet district. It has modern equipment installed for waste and wastewater management.

The visitors were demonstrated the whole chain of waste management from the reception of waste to environmentally safe high-temperature decontamination and processing of liquid and solid industrials waste, food and other waste. At the plastic and cardboard waste compaction area the participants have observed the process of PET bottles compaction.

At the end of the visit, West Dala representatives answered additional questions about the WMF operations.
